Flights from Invercargill to Johannesburg
Current requirements for travelling from Invercargill to Johannesburg
Frequently asked questions
More about Invercargill to Johannesburg
Other flights from Invercargill
Invercargill to Auckland
Invercargill to Christchurch
Invercargill to Wellington
Invercargill to Hamilton
Invercargill to New Plymouth
Invercargill to Rotorua
Invercargill to Nelson
Invercargill to Manila
Invercargill to Palmerston North
Invercargill to Auckland
Invercargill to Christchurch
Invercargill to Wellington
Invercargill to Hamilton
Invercargill to New Plymouth
Invercargill to Rotorua
Invercargill to Nelson
Invercargill to Manila
Invercargill to Palmerston North
Invercargill to Brisbane
Invercargill to Tauranga
Invercargill to Napier City
Invercargill to Gisborne
Invercargill to Sydney
Invercargill to Taupo
Invercargill to Tacloban City
Invercargill to Nadi
Invercargill to Perth
Invercargill to Gold Coast
Invercargill to Rome
Auckland to Johannesburg
Wellington to Johannesburg
Christchurch to Johannesburg
Cape Town to Johannesburg
Queenstown to Johannesburg
London to Johannesburg
Nuremberg to Johannesburg
Durban to Johannesburg
Perth to Johannesburg
Napier City to Johannesburg
Sydney to Johannesburg
Bali to Johannesburg
Dunedin to Johannesburg
Proserpine to Johannesburg
Melbourne to Johannesburg
New Plymouth to Johannesburg
Brisbane to Johannesburg
Harare to Johannesburg
Windhoek to Johannesburg
George to Johannesburg